Real-World Embroidery Use Cases

I tested the Cat Vector Illustration in Three Color on several fabrics and projects, and it performed well across the board. For example, when I used it on a cotton tote bag, the design held up nicely with clear stitching and good visibility. The three-color scheme allowed for easy differentiation between the orange fur, black outline, and white highlights, which helped maintain visual clarity even at smaller sizes.

On a sweatshirt, the design looked great with a medium stitch density. The black outlines provided definition, while the white areas added contrast without being too harsh. I also tried it on a baby onesie, and the softness of the fabric complemented the design’s gentle style. It felt like the perfect addition to a nursery decor set or a personalized gift for a cat lover.

This design also works well as an embroidered patch. The simplicity of the vector makes it ideal for applique or satin stitch applications, and the three colors allow for easy customization based on the fabric background.

Where to Be Cautious: Practical Considerations

While the Cat Vector Illustration in Three Color is generally reliable, there are a few situations where extra care is needed. On small hoop sizes, the design may require some adjustment to ensure all elements are included. If you’re working with textured or stretchy fabrics, the stitch density might need to be adjusted to prevent puckering or distortion.

For dark fabrics, the white areas of the design can be tricky. Depending on the thread color and fabric, the white might not show up as clearly as intended. I recommend testing it on a similar fabric before committing to a larger project. Similarly, if you’re planning to use this on curved surfaces like caps or hats, you’ll want to make sure the design is properly centered and scaled.

When it comes to intricate details, such as tiny lettering or complex corners, the design holds up well—but only if the file is properly optimized. Always check the original vector files (EPS, SVG) for any inconsistencies before converting them to embroidery formats.
